Vice president of marketing & communications demographics research summary. Zippia estimates vice president of marketing & communications demographics and statistics in the United States by using a database of 30 million profiles. Our vice president of marketing & communications estimates are verified against BLS, Census, and current job openings data for accuracy. Zippia's data science team found the following key facts about vice presidents of marketing & communications after extensive research and analysis:

  • There are over 41,084 vice presidents of marketing & communications currently employed in the United States.
  • 47.0% of all vice presidents of marketing & communications are women, while 53.0% are men.
  • The average vice president of marketing & communications age is 39 years old.
  • The most common ethnicity of vice presidents of marketing & communications is White (74.6%), followed by Hispanic or Latino (8.7%), Asian (8.2%) and Unknown (5.3%).
  • Vice presidents of marketing & communications are most in-demand in New York, NY.
  • The real estate industry is the highest-paying for vice presidents of marketing & communications.
  • 10% of all vice presidents of marketing & communications are LGBT.

Vice president of marketing & communications gender ratio by year

YearMaleFemale
201072.00%28.00%
201171.70%28.30%
201272.26%27.74%
201372.19%27.81%
201470.55%29.45%
201570.12%29.88%
201670.00%30.00%
201769.06%30.94%
201855.26%44.74%
201954.18%45.82%
202052.57%47.43%
202152.96%47.04%

Vice president of marketing & communications race and ethnicity over time

See how vice president of marketing & communications racial and ethnic diversity trended since 2010 according to the United States Census Bureau data.

Vice president of marketing & communications race and ethnicity by year

YearWhiteBlack or African AmericanAsianHispanic or Latino
201083.20%3.77%4.83%6.40%
201182.97%3.67%5.02%6.54%
201281.98%4.30%4.92%6.96%
201382.82%3.53%5.17%6.71%
201481.64%4.15%5.07%7.25%
201581.26%3.56%5.82%7.41%
201680.88%3.69%5.85%7.32%
201780.80%3.66%6.04%7.44%
201879.66%3.34%7.30%7.37%
201977.79%3.14%8.02%8.43%
202075.01%3.41%8.18%8.85%
202174.58%3.04%8.15%8.67%
